Diagnostics fault code check

Diagnostics fault codes can appear on your dashboard for a variety of reasons. Some of these problems relate to the engine and transmission while others are more general in the nature. A diagnostic scanner tool is useful in diagnosing and resolving any issues with your vehicle. There are a variety of trouble codes and determining which are most common will help you determine which issues require immediate attention.

A simple diagnostic scan tool will require an OBD II 16-pin diagnostic connector, which is normally located under the dashboard. The majority of newer cars utilize the same connector, though different models and makes may use a different one. The diagnostic connector of your car's ECU can be located in the owner's manual or online by searching for the vehicle-specific tool.

One of the most useful features of diagnostic scan tools is the ability of determining the codes that are related to specific issues. The majority of codes start with the letter "p," which refers to problems with the powertrain. However, some professional scanners will also display b (body) as well as C (chassis) and the u (computer or communications problems) codes.

A diagnostic fault code check can be used to determine and fix any problem with your car's warning lights or error messages. For example, if the check engine light is flashing, it indicates that a serious issue has occurred. Diagnostic fault code checks in the car software can help you determine the nature and extent of the problem.

An EGR system check engine light could be an indication that your EGR system is not functioning properly. The EGR system assists the engine reduce nitrogen oxide emissions as well as temperatures. A failure in this system could result in a lower fuel efficiency rough idle or pre-ignition knocking. If you experience any of these symptoms then take your vehicle to a trusted mechanic in order to determine the cause.
